Joseph Rank Ltd

  • Corporate body
  • 1875-1962

Joseph Rank began working at a small windmill in Hull in 1875. In 1885 he built his first roller mill, Alexandra Mill, and in 1891 the much larger Clarence Mill. In 1899 the company was incorporated as Joseph Rank Ltd. Many other milling companies were purchased, and new mills constructed in ports around the country.

On Joseph Rank's death in 1945 his son James became chairman, followed by his brother J Arthur Rank in 1952. In 1962 the company acquired Hovis-McDougall, becoming Ranks Hovis McDougall Limited.

Swann, William (1855-1931), miller

  • Person
  • 1855 - 1931

Miller at Lytham Windmill 1895-1919. Previously a miller at Treales Windmill and at Preston, Lancashire.

Ranks Hovis McDougall Ltd

  • Corporate body
  • 1962-2014

Formed when Joseph Rank Ltd acquired Hovis McDougall in 1962.

Hovis Ltd (2014 onwards)

  • Corporate body
  • 2014

The limited company was formed in 2014 as a joint venture between Premier Foods, owners of the Hovis brand and the Gores Group.
